Close Menu
Hardware Sorftware and WebHardware Sorftware and Web
    What's Hot

    Top 12 Google Chrome Extensions for Productivity

    January 23, 2025

    Introduction to Linux: A Beginner’s Guide

    June 25, 2023

    Introduction to Internet of Things (IoT) and Smart Home Technology

    June 25, 2023
    Facebook X (Twitter) Instagram
    • Demos
    • Computing
    • Buy Now
    Facebook X (Twitter) Instagram
    Hardware Sorftware and WebHardware Sorftware and Web
    • Home
    • Features
      • Typography
      • Contact
      • View All On Demos
    • Typography
    • Buy Now
    • Computing
    Hardware Sorftware and WebHardware Sorftware and Web
    Home»Uncategorized»HTML5: The Foundation of Modern Web Development
    Uncategorized

    HTML5: The Foundation of Modern Web Development

    adminBy adminJune 24, 2023Updated:June 24, 2023No Comments6 Mins Read
    Facebook Twitter Pinterest LinkedIn Tumblr WhatsApp Email
    Share
    Facebook Twitter LinkedIn WhatsApp Pinterest Email

    In the world of web development, HTML5 stands as the cornerstone that enables the creation of modern, dynamic, and interactive websites. HTML, short for Hypertext Markup Language, is a markup language used to structure the content of web pages. With the introduction of HTML5, web developers gained access to a host of new features and functionalities that have revolutionized the web development landscape. In this article, we will explore the significance of HTML5 and its role in shaping the modern web.

    Table of Contents

    1. Introduction to HTML5
    2. The Evolution of HTML
    3. Key Features of HTML5
    4. Semantic Markup
    5. Improved Multimedia Support
    6. Canvas and Scalable Vector Graphics (SVG)
    7. Geolocation and Device Access
    8. Local Storage and Web Storage
    9. Offline Web Applications
    10. Responsive Web Design
    11. Accessibility
    12. Browser Compatibility
    13. SEO-Friendly Structure
    14. Conclusion
    15. FAQs

    1. Introduction to HTML5

    HTML5 is the fifth major revision of the HTML standard. It was introduced with the goal of providing web developers with a more powerful and versatile set of tools for creating web pages and applications. HTML5 incorporates various new features, APIs, and markup elements that enhance the functionality and user experience of websites.

    2. The Evolution of HTML

    HTML has evolved significantly since its inception. With each new version, HTML has introduced new elements and attributes to accommodate the changing needs of web development. HTML5 represents a major leap forward in terms of capabilities, compatibility, and consistency across different platforms and devices.

    3. Key Features of HTML5

    HTML5 brings a plethora of features that have transformed the way websites are built and interacted with. Some of the key features of HTML5 include:

    4. Semantic Markup

    Semantic markup is one of the essential aspects of HTML5. It allows web developers to structure web content in a way that is meaningful and easily understandable by both humans and search engines. Semantic elements such as <header>, <nav>, <section>, and <article> provide a clearer and more organized structure to web pages.

    5. Improved Multimedia Support

    HTML5 introduces native support for multimedia elements, eliminating the need for third-party plugins like Flash. With the <video> and <audio> tags, developers can easily embed videos and audio files directly into web pages. This improves performance, accessibility, and compatibility across different devices and browsers.

    6. Canvas and Scalable Vector Graphics (SVG)

    HTML5 includes the <canvas> element, which provides a powerful drawing surface for rendering graphics, animations, and interactive visualizations using JavaScript. Additionally, SVG support allows for the creation of scalable and resolution-independent vector graphics directly within HTML.

    7. Geolocation and Device Access

    HTML5 offers geolocation capabilities, enabling websites to access a user’s location information. This feature has opened up new possibilities for location-based services, mapping applications, and personalized user experiences. HTML5 also provides access to device-specific features such as cameras and microphones through APIs, enabling functionalities like video calls and image capture.

    8. Local Storage and Web Storage

    HTML5 introduced local storage mechanisms, such as the localStorage and sessionStorage objects, which allow websites to store data locally on the user’s device. This enables offline usage, persistent data storage, and improved performance by reducing the need for server requests.

    9. Offline Web Applications

    HTML5 enables the creation of offline web applications by using the Application Cache API. Developers can specify which files and resources should be cached, allowing users to access and interact with web applications even when they are offline or experiencing a poor internet connection.

    10. Responsive Web Design

    Responsive web design, a crucial aspect of modern web development, is made easier with HTML5. The introduction of media queries and new layout elements provides developers with the tools to create websites that adapt and respond to different screen sizes and devices. This ensures a consistent and optimized user experience across desktops, tablets, and smartphones.

    11. Accessibility

    HTML5 places a strong emphasis on accessibility. With the inclusion of semantic elements, ARIA (Accessible Rich Internet Applications) attributes, and improved form validation, developers can create websites that are more accessible to individuals with disabilities. This promotes inclusivity and ensures that web content can be easily consumed by a wider audience.

    12. Browser Compatibility

    HTML5 is designed to be compatible with modern web browsers, ensuring a consistent experience for users regardless of the platform or device they are using. While older browsers may not support all HTML5 features, there are various techniques and libraries available to provide fallback options and ensure graceful degradation.

    13. SEO-Friendly Structure

    HTML5’s semantic markup and improved structure contribute to better search engine optimization (SEO). Search engines can better understand the content and context of web pages, resulting in improved visibility and higher rankings in search results.

    Conclusion

    HTML5 has revolutionized the world of web development by providing powerful features, enhanced multimedia support, improved accessibility, and greater flexibility. With its semantic markup, multimedia capabilities, canvas, geolocation, local storage, and more, HTML5 has paved the way for modern web experiences. As the foundation of the web, HTML5 continues to shape the future of web development.

    FAQs

    1. Q: Is HTML5 backward compatible with older versions of HTML? A: Yes, HTML5 is designed to be backward compatible, meaning that websites built using older versions of HTML will still function correctly in modern browsers.
    2. Q: Is it necessary to learn HTML before learning HTML5? A: While HTML5 builds upon the foundation of HTML, it is possible to start learning HTML5 directly. However, having a basic understanding of HTML concepts will be beneficial in grasping HTML5’s advanced features.
    3. Q: Can I use HTML5 features in all web browsers? A: Most modern web browsers support HTML5 features, but older browsers may have limited support. It is recommended to implement fallback options or use libraries to ensure compatibility across different browsers.
    4. Q: How can I stay updated with the latest HTML5 developments? A: Keeping up with web development blogs, forums, and official documentation is a great way to stay informed about the latest HTML5 updates, best practices, and emerging trends.
    5. Q: Is HTML5 the only language I need to learn for web development? A: While HTML5 is essential for structuring web content, it is recommended to complement it with CSS for styling and JavaScript for interactivity to become a well-rounded web developer.
    Share. Facebook Twitter Pinterest LinkedIn Tumblr WhatsApp Email
    admin
    • Website

    Related Posts

    Top 12 Google Chrome Extensions for Productivity

    January 23, 2025

    The top 10 Hosting Providers in 2023

    June 24, 2023

    Web Hosting Options: Shared hosting, VPS, cloud hosting, and more

    June 24, 2023

    Website Performance Monitoring and Optimization Tools

    June 24, 2023

    Mobile App Development: Exploring frameworks like React Native and Flutter

    June 24, 2023

    Cross-Browser Compatibility: Ensuring your website works well across different browsers

    June 24, 2023
    Add A Comment
    Leave A Reply Cancel Reply

    Don't Miss

    Top 12 Google Chrome Extensions for Productivity

    By adminJanuary 23, 2025

    In our digital age, productivity tools are essential for managing tasks efficiently. Google Chrome, a…

    Introduction to Linux: A Beginner’s Guide

    June 25, 2023

    Introduction to Internet of Things (IoT) and Smart Home Technology

    June 25, 2023

    Understanding IP Addresses and Subnets

    June 25, 2023
    Stay In Touch
    • Facebook
    • Twitter
    • Pinterest
    • Instagram
    • YouTube
    • Vimeo
    Our Picks

    Top 12 Google Chrome Extensions for Productivity

    January 23, 2025

    Introduction to Linux: A Beginner’s Guide

    June 25, 2023

    Introduction to Internet of Things (IoT) and Smart Home Technology

    June 25, 2023

    Understanding IP Addresses and Subnets

    June 25, 2023
    Demo
    About Us
    About Us

    Your source for the lifestyle news. This demo is crafted specifically to exhibit the use of the theme as a lifestyle site. Visit our main page for more demos.

    We're accepting new partnerships right now.

    Email Us: info@example.com
    Contact: +1-320-0123-451

    Our Picks
    New Comments
      Facebook X (Twitter) Instagram Pinterest
      • Home
      • Computing
      • Buy Now
      © 2025 ThemeSphere. Designed by ThemeSphere.

      Type above and press Enter to search. Press Esc to cancel.